Next thing is the tags. Pls do care to input more meaningful tags which will help you in the long run. For example, i write about bodybuilding. so i'd include the tags weights, exercises, supplements, workout schedules etc etc... u got my point?. All related to bodybuilding. So, those who search for any of these terms have a probability to find one of my articles.
